BACKGROUND: Subcutaneous immunotherapy (SCIT) can induce systemic reactions (SRs) in certain patients, but the underlying mechanisms remain to be fully elucidated. METHODS: AR patients who were undergoing standardized HDM SCIT (Alutard, ALK) between 2018 and 2022 were screened. Those who experienced two consecutive SRs were included in the study group. A control group was established, matched 1:1 by gender, age, and disease duration with the study group, who did not experience SRs during SCIT. Clinical and immunological parameters were recorded and analyzed both before SCIT and after 1 year of treatment. RESULTS: A total of 161 patients were included, with 79 (49.07%) in the study group. The study group had a higher proportion of AR combined asthma (26.8% vs. 51.8%, p < 0.001) and higher levels of sIgE to HDM and HDM components (all p < .001). Serum IL-4 and IL-13 levels in the study group were higher than those in the control group (p < .05). The study group received a lower maintenance dosage of HDM extracts injections than control group due to SRs (50000SQ vs. 100000SQ, p < .05). After 1 year of SCIT, the VAS score, the lung function parameters of asthmatic patients over 14 years old significantly improved in both groups (all p < .05). After a 7-day exposure to 20 µg/mL HDM extracts, the percentages of Th1, Th17, Tfh10, and Th17.1 in PBMCs decreased, while the Tfh13 cells significantly increased in the study group (p < .05). CONCLUSION: The type 2 inflammatory response is augmented in HDM-induced AR patients who experienced SRs during SCIT. Despite this, SCIT remains effective in these patients when administered with low-dosage allergen extracts.

Introduction: Allergic rhinitis (AR) is an upper airway inflammatory disease of the nasal mucosa. Conventional treatments such as symptomatic pharmacotherapy and allergen-specific immunotherapy have considerable limitations and drawbacks. As an emerging therapy with regenerative potential and immunomodulatory effect, mesenchymal stem cell-derived exosomes (MSC-Exos) have recently been trialed for the treatment of various inflammatory and autoimmune diseases. Methods: In order to achieve sustained and protected release of MSC-Exos for intranasal administration, we fabricated Poly(lactic-co-glycolic acid) (PLGA) micro and nanoparticles-encapsulated MSC-Exos (PLGA-Exos) using mechanical double emulsion for local treatment of AR. Preclinical in vivo imaging, ELISA, qPCR, flow cytometry, immunohistochemical staining, and multiomics sequencing were used for phenotypic and mechanistic evaluation of the therapeutic effect of PLGA-Exos in vitro and in vivo. Results: The results showed that our PLGA platform could efficiently encapsulate and release the exosomes in a sustained manner. At protein level, PLGA-Exos treatment upregulated IL-2, IL-10 and IFN-γ, and downregulated IL-4, IL-17 and antigen-specific IgE in ovalbumin (OVA)-induced AR mice. At cellular level, exosomes treatment reduced Th2 cells, increased Tregs, and reestablished Th1/Th2 balance. At tissue level, PLGA-Exos significantly attenuated the infiltration of immune cells (e.g., eosinophils and goblet cells) in nasal mucosa. Finally, multiomics analysis discovered several signaling cascades, e.g., peroxisome proliferator-activated receptor (PPAR) pathway and glycolysis pathway, that might mechanistically support the immunomodulatory effect of PLGA-Exos. Discussion: For the first time, we present a biomaterial-facilitated local delivery system for stem cell-derived exosomes as a novel and promising strategy for AR treatment.

Background: There is controversy on whether allergic contact dermatitis (ACD) is associated with atopy. Research on eczema and the risk of ACD is mixed, and there is sparse literature on other atopic conditions. Objective: Our study examined the prevalence of several atopic conditions, including allergic rhinitis, eczema, asthma, and food allergies in patients with ACD, and compared these to patients without ACD. Methods: We retrospectively reviewed adult patients ages ≥ 18 years with ACD (n = 162) with positive patch testing results and documented any history of atopy, including childhood eczema, asthma, allergic rhinitis, and immunoglobulin E-mediated food allergy. The prevalence of atopic conditions was compared between our ACD cohort and controls without ACD (n = 163) from our electronic medical records system (age and gender matched). Results: Among our patients with ACD, 53 (33%) had allergic rhinitis, 22 (14%) had childhood eczema, 32 (20%) had asthma, and 8 (5%) had food allergies. We observed that the odds of atopy overall (n = 76) in the ACD group compared with the control group were increased (odds ratio [OR] 1.88; p = 0.007). Allergic rhinitis was the highest risk factor (n = 53) with an OR of 12.64 (p < 0.001). Childhood eczema (n = 22) was also increased in the ACD group (OR 2.4; p = 0.026). The odds of asthma and food allergy in the ACD group were also increased; however, the difference was not statistically significant from the control group (OR 1.76 [p = 0.071] and OR 2.76 [p = 0.139], respectively). Conclusion: Patients with ACD had increased odds of eczema, allergic rhinitis, and atopic conditions overall. Asthma and food allergies were not found to have a statistically significant correlation. Larger studies that delve into atopic risk factors in ACD would be important to confirm these findings.

"Allergic fungal sinusitis (AFS)" is typically diagnosed using radiologic images like computed tomography (CT) scans and magnetic resonance imaging (MRI), with the "Hounsfield unit (HU)" in CT scans and T2-weighted images (T2WI) in MRI serving as reliable objective parameters. However, diagnosing AFS might be difficult because of possible signal changes and densities caused by variations in the secretion concentration in the sinus. Few studies have compared the diagnostic performance of MRI and CT scans. This study aimed to investigate the value of MRI signal intensity in evaluating AFS compared with CT HUs. This retrospective study included 111 patients with pathologically confirmed AFS who underwent CT imaging followed by MRI evaluation at King Saud Medical City, Riyadh, Saudi Arabia, from January 2012 to December 2022. Radiographic densities of sinus opacities on CT scan, including the mean HU values, and MRI findings, including signal voids on T1-weighted images and T2WI, were gathered and analyzed. To determine the efficacy of these radiographic characteristics in predicting the disease and the best cutoff value, we employed receiver operator characteristic curves. The mean age was 31.9 ±â€…15.6 years, and most patients were 74 females (66.7%). The main symptom was nasal obstruction in 73 patients (65.8%). In comparison, between HU and signal void on T2WI, there was moderate predictive performance [area under the curve: 0.856, P = .001]. An ideal HU cutoff value of 69.50 HU was obtained with a sensitivity of 100% and a specificity of 44.7%. However, the receiver operator characteristic for T1-weighted images could not be plotted, as no signal was avoided to predict AFS and it was not statistically significant (area under the curve: 0.566; P = .287). The study found a CT HU of 69.5 can predict MRI T2WI signal values with a void signal, aiding in diagnostic workup and evaluation for AFS.

Background: Allergic rhinitis (AR) is a complex disease in which gene-environment interactions contribute to its pathogenesis. Epigenetic modifications, such as N6-methyladenosine (m6A) modification of mRNA, play important roles in regulating gene expression in multiple physiological and pathological processes. However, the function of m6A modification in AR and the inflammatory response is poorly understood. Methods: We used the ovalbumin (OVA) and aluminum hydroxide to induce an AR mouse model. Nasal symptoms, histopathology, and serum cytokines were examined. We performed combined m6A and RNA sequencing to analyze changes in m6A modification profiles. Reverse transcription-quantitative polymerase chain reaction (RT-qPCR) and methylated RNA immunoprecipitation sequencing qPCR (MeRIP-qPCR) were used to verify differential methylation of mRNAs and the m6A methylation level. Knockdown or inhibition of Alkbh5 in nasal mucosa of mice was mediated by lentiviral infection or IOX1 treatment. Results: We showed that m6A was enriched in a group of genes involved in MAPK signaling pathway. Moreover, we identified a MAPK pathway involving Map3k8, Erk2, and Nfκb1 that may play a role in the disrupted inflammatory response associated with nasal inflammation. The m6A eraser, Alkbh5, was highly expressed in the nasal mucosa of AR model mice. Furthermore, knockdown of Alkbh5 expression by lentiviral infection resulted in high MAPK pathway activity and a significant nasal mucosa inflammatory response. Our findings indicate that ALKBH5-mediated m6A dysregulation likely contributes to a nasal inflammatory response via the MAPK pathway. Conclusion: Together, our data show that m6A dysregulation mediated by ALKBH5, is likely to contribute to inflammation of the nasal mucosa via the MAPK signaling pathway, suggesting that ALKBH5 is a potential biomarker for AR treatment.

Chronic exposure to harmful pollutants, chemicals, and pathogens from the environment can lead to pathological changes in the epithelial barrier, which increase the risk of developing an allergy. During allergic inflammation, epithelial cells send proinflammatory signals to group 2 innate lymphoid cell (ILC2s) and eosinophils, which require energy and resources to mediate their activation, cytokine/chemokine secretion, and mobilization of other cells. This review aims to provide an overview of the metabolic regulation in allergic asthma, atopic dermatitis (AD), and allergic rhinitis (AR), highlighting its underlying mechanisms and phenotypes, and the potential metabolic regulatory roles of eosinophils and ILC2s. Eosinophils and ILC2s regulate allergic inflammation through lipid mediators, particularly cysteinyl leukotrienes (CysLTs) and prostaglandins (PGs). Arachidonic acid (AA)-derived metabolites and Sphinosine-1-phosphate (S1P) are significant metabolic markers that indicate immune dysfunction and epithelial barrier dysfunction in allergy. Notably, eosinophils are promoters of allergic symptoms and exhibit greater metabolic plasticity compared to ILC2s, directly involved in promoting allergic symptoms. Our findings suggest that metabolomic analysis provides insights into the complex interactions between immune cells, epithelial cells, and environmental factors. Potential therapeutic targets have been highlighted to further understand the metabolic regulation of eosinophils and ILC2s in allergy. Future research in metabolomics can facilitate the development of novel diagnostics and therapeutics for future application.

Objective:Neosensitizations may be occur during the allergen specific immunotherapy(AIT) due to the differences between allergen vaccine's content and a patient's molecular sensitization profile. This study investigates whether AIT with HDM extract changes the sensitization profile, whether de novo sensitization occurs, and the clinical importance of the neosensitization. Methods:Fifty-three patients with HDM allergic rhinitis ,with/without asthma, patients were received one year HDM subcutaneous AIT . Fourteen patients were recruited as control group and received only necessary medications. Serum samples were collected at baseline, 6thmoths and 12thof AIT, respectively. Serum samples were tested specific IgE against Der p, Der p 1/2/3 and Der f, Der f 1/2/3, as well as IgG4 against Der p, Der p 1/2 and Der f, Der f 1/2. VAS were collected at the time-points as well. Results:In AIT group, Der p, Der p 1/3, and Der f 1/3 specific IgE levels were significantly higher after one-year treatment, especially for Der p 3. There were 69.2%(18/26) patients whose Der p 3 specific IgE below 0.35 kU/L at baseline but became positive(>0.35 kU/L) after treatment, that is, neosensitization occurred. All tested allergen specific IgG4 level significantly increased after one year AIT treatment and the VAS declined dramatically. However, for patients with neosensitization and without neosensitization, there were no significantly changes concerning to IgG4 level and VAS. Conclusion:Patients undergoing AIT might have a risk of neosensitization to the allergen components in the vaccines. However, the clinical importance of the neosensitization remains unclear and warrants further studies.

Objective:To investigate the distribution of common allergens and indoor factors influencing the severity of allergic rhinitis in patients from the Chaoshan region. Methods:Patients diagnosed with allergic rhinitis from Shantou, Jieyang, and Chaozhou were selected for serum allergen-specific IgE testing. A questionnaire survey was conducted to analyze the distribution of allergens and indoor factors affecting the severity of the disease. Results:A total of 1 800 questionnaires were collected, with 1 646 valid responses, resulting in an effective response rate of 91.4%. Among the 1 646 included patients with allergic rhinitis, there were 1 285 children(≤14 years) ,361 adolescents and adults(>14 years);of which 999 were males and 647 were females. The top three allergens with the highest positive rates were house dust mites(n=1 457, 88.5%), milk(n=569, 34.6%), and crab(n=360, 21.9%). The proportions of allergen sensitization to house dust mites, house dust, dog dander, egg white, milk, fish, crab, shrimp, and beef showed statistically significant differences between children and adolescents and adults(P<0.01). There were also statistically significant differences in crab and shrimp sensitization between males and females(P<0.01). Multivariate analysis revealed that active/passive smoking, religious rituals, air conditioning usage, pet ownership, air purifier usage, and bedding drying were indoor factors influencing the severity of allergic rhinitis. Among them, active/passive smoking, religious rituals, air conditioning usage, and pet ownership were risk factors for exacerbating the disease, while air purifier usage and bedding drying were protective factors. Conclusion:House dust mites are the most common allergen in patients with allergic rhinitis in the Chaoshan region. Active/passive smoking, religious rituals, air conditioning usage, and pet ownership can worsen the condition, while air purifier usage and bedding drying can help control the disease. The results of this study can provide clinical reference.

BACKGROUND: Allergic rhinitis (AR) is a common inflammatory disease of the nasal mucosa that is characterized by symptoms such as sneezing, nasal congestion, nasal itching, and rhinorrhoea. In recent years, acupoint herbal patching (AHP) therapy has gained a growing interest as a potential management option for AR. This systematic review and meta-analysis will evaluate the clinical research evidence on the effectiveness and safety of AHP as a treatment option for AR outside of the Sanfu or Sanjiu days (summer or winter solstice). The results of this review will provide up-to-date evidence-based guidance for healthcare providers and individuals seeking alternative treatments for AR. METHODS: A comprehensive search of electronic databases (PubMed, Cochrane Central Register of Controlled Trials (CENTRAL), EMBASE, China National Knowledge Infrastructure (CNKI), CQVIP, Sino-Med, and Wanfang Databases) will be conducted from their inception to June 2023. The inclusion criteria will be limited to randomized controlled trials that evaluate the effectiveness or efficacy of non-Sanfu or non-Sanjiu AHP for AR. The primary outcome measure will be the total nasal symptom score. The methodological quality of included studies will be assessed using the Revised Cochrane risk-of-bias tool for randomized trials (RoB 2), and meta-analyses will be performed using RevMan (V.5.3) statistical software. The Grading of Recommendations Assessment, Development and Evaluation (GRADE) approach will be used to determine the certainty of evidence. DISCUSSION: This systematic review and meta-analysis will provide valuable insights into the effectiveness and safety of non-Sanfu or non-Sanjiu AHP as a treatment option for AR. The study aims to produce a high-quality review by adhering to PRISMA-P guidelines and using clinical guideline recommended outcome measures. The results of this review may offer additional treatment options for AR patients who seek complementary and alternative therapies, and hold significant implications for future research in this field. Overall, this study has the potential to inform clinical practice and improve patient outcomes. SYSTEMATIC REVIEW REGISTRATION: PROSPERO CRD42022181322.

Objective: To determine the causal relationship between educational attainment and the risk of allergic rhinitis and (or) eczema using Mendelian randomization (MR) analyses. Methods: This study was a secondary data analysis based on the summary data of genome-wide association studies (GWAS), which involved 293 723 participants (educational attainment) from the Social Science Genetics Association Consortium and 462 013 participants [allergic rhinitis and (or) eczema] from the UK Biobank. Genetic variants that were closely related to educational attainment were identified as instrumental variables. Two-sample MR analyses, including inverse-variance weighted (IVW), MR-Egger regression, weighted median method and weighted model-based estimation, were performed to investigate the causal relationship between educational attainment and the risk of allergic rhinitis and (or) eczema, in which the odds ratio (OR) values were used as indicators. Results: A total of 70 single-nucleotide polymorphisms (SNPs) were chosen as instrumental variables. The MR-Egger regression results suggested that the genetic pleiotropy was unlikely to bias our results (P=0.107). In the univariable MR analyses, IVW regression showed that the risk of allergic rhinitis and (or) eczema was OR=1.044 (95%CI: 1.020-1.069, P<0.001) and OR=1.170 (95%CI: 1.074-1.256, P<0.001), respectively, for the increase in the duration of education by one year or one standard deviation (SD) (3.71 years). In the reverse MR analysis, IVW regression showed little evidence that allergic rhinitis and (or) eczema affected educational attainment (OR=1.020, 95%CI: 0.927-1.023, P=0.683). The results of the weighted median method and weighted mode-based estimation were consistent with the results of IVW. Conclusion: This study suggests that there is a positive causal relationship between educational attainment and the risk of allergic rhinitis and (or) eczema, which means that educational attainment can increase the occurrence of allergic rhinitis and (or) eczema.

Objective: To investigate the distribution rules of artemisia pollen and the clinical sensitization characteristics of allergic rhinitis (AR) induced by artemisia pollen in three urban and rural areas of Inner Mongolia. Methods: From March to October 2019, in 3 central cities (Chifeng, Hohhot, Ordos) and rural areas of Inner Mongolia, an epidemiological investigation method combining multi-stage stratified random sampling and face-to-face questionnaire survey was adopted to screen suspected AR patients, and skin prick test (SPT) was applied for diagnosis. At the same time, pollen monitoring was carried out in 3 areas to analyze the distribution and clinical sensitization characteristics of artemisia pollen.SPSS26.0 statistical software was used to process all the data. Chi-square test was used to compare rates among different age, sex, region and nationality, Spearman test was used to describe correlation analysis, and pairwise comparison of positive rates among multiple samples was used Bonferroni method. Results: Among the 6 393 subjects, 1 093 cases were diagnosed with AR, and the prevalence of AR was 17.10% (1 093/6 393). Among them, pollen-induced allergic rhinitis, the prevalence of PiAR was 10.97% (701/6 393), accounting for 64.14%(701/1 093).The highest incidence was in the youth group (20-39 years old), accounting for 46.94% (329/701).The diagnosed prevalence was higher in females than in males (11.35% vs. 10.64%, χ2 value 12.304, P<0.001).The prevalence rate of ethnic minority was higher than that of Han nationality (13.01% vs. 10.65%, χ2 value 6.296, P=0.008).The prevalence in urban areas was also significantly higher than that in rural areas (18.40% vs. 5.50%, χ2 value 10.497, P<0.001).There was significant difference in prevalence rate among the three regions in Inner Mongolia (6.06% in Chifeng, 13.46% in Hohhot, 16.39% in Ordos, χ2 value 70.054, P<0.001).The main clinical symptoms of artemisia PiAR were sneezing (95.58%), nasal congestion (91.73%) and nasal itching (89.30%).Allergic conjunctivitis accounted for 79.60% (558/701), chronic sinusitis for 55.63% (390/701), asthma for 23.25% (163/701).The pattern of artemisia pollen sensitization was mainly multiple sensitization, and the frequency of clinical symptoms and clinical diseases induced by hypersensitization with other allergens accounted for more than that caused by single artemisia pollen. The spread period of Artemisia pollen in the three regions was from June to October, and the peak state was in August in summer. The peak time of clinical symptoms in artemisia PiAR patients was about 2 weeks earlier than the peak time of pollen concentration, and the two were significantly positively correlated (R=0.7671, P<0.001). Conclusion: Artemisia pollens are the dominant pollens in late summer and early autumn in Inner Mongolia, and the prevalence of artemisia PiAR is high. Controlling the spread of Artemisia pollens is of great significance for the prevention and treatment of AR.

Objective: To explore the optimal regimen of standardized mite allergen immunotherapy for airway allergic diseases in children, and to observe the clinical efficacy, safety and compliance. Method: Use a retrospective real-world study, clinical data from 156 children aged 5-16 years who received subcutaneous immunotherapy (SCIT) with double mite allergen preparation in the pediatrics department of the Third Affiliated Hospital of Sun Yat sen University from June 2019 to September 2020 were selected for allergic rhinitis (AR) and/or allergic asthma (bronchial asthma, BA), including gender, age, total VAS(visual analogue scale) score and CSMS(combined symptom and medication scores) score at different time points (before treatment, 4-6 months, 1 year, and 2 years after initiation of desensitization), peripheral blood eosinophil counts (EOS), serum total IgE (tIgE), specific IgE (tIgE), and serum IgE (tIgE), specific IgE (sIgE), tIgG4, and incidence of local and systemic adverse reactions. All patients had a consistent regimen during the initial treatment phase (dose-escalation phase), which was performed as directed. Among them, 81 cases (observation group) continued to continue subcutaneous injection of 1 ml of vial No. 3 every 4-6 weeks during the dose maintenance phase, while 75 cases (control group) followed the old traditional regimen during the maintenance phase (i.e., change to a new vial to halve the amount of vial No. 3 by 0.5 ml, and then 0.75 ml after 1-2 weeks, and 1 ml in a further interval of 1-2 weeks). The clinical efficacy, safety and adherence to the treatment were compared between the two groups. Results: A total of 81 cases of 156 children were included in the observation group, of which 58 children with AR, 15 children with BA, and 8 children with AR combined with BA; 75 cases were included in the conventional control group, of which 52 children with AR, 16 children with BA, and 7 children with AR combined with BA. In terms of safety, the difference in the incidence of local and systemic adverse reactions between the two groups was not statistically significant (χ2=1.541 for local adverse reactions in the control group, χ2=0.718 for the observation group; χ2=0.483 for systemic adverse reactions in the control group, χ2=0.179 for the observation group, P value >0.05 for all of these), and there were no grade Ⅱ or higher systemic adverse reactions in any of them. In the control group, there were 15 cases of dropout at 2 years of follow-up, with a dropout rate of 20.0%; in the observation group, there were 7 cases of dropout at 2 years of follow-up, with a dropout rate of 8.6%, and there was a statistically significant difference in the dropout rates of the patients in the two groups (χ2=4.147, P<0.05). Comparison of serological indexes and efficacy (compared with baseline at 3 different time points after treatment, i.e., 4-6 months, 1 year and 2 years after treatment), CSMS scores of the observation group and the conventional control group at 4-6 months, 1 year and 2 years after treatment were significantly decreased compared with the baseline status (t-values of the conventional group were 13.783, 20.086 and 20.384, respectively, all P-values <0.001, and t-values of the observation group were 15.480, 27.087, 28.938, all P-values <0.001), and VAS scores also decreased significantly from baseline status in both groups at 4-6 months, 1 year, and 2 years of treatment (t-values of 14.008, 17.963, and 27.512 in the conventional control group, respectively, with all P-values <0.001, and t-values of 9.436, 13.184, and 22.377 in the observation group, respectively; all P-values <0.001). Intergroup comparisons showed no statistically significant differences in CSMS at baseline status, 4-6 months, 1 year and 2 years (t-values 0.621, 0.473, 1.825, and 0.342, respectively, and P-values 0.536, 0.637, 0.070, and 0.733, respectively), and VAS was no statistically significant difference in comparison between groups at different time points (t-values of 1.663, 0.095, 0.305, 0.951, P-values of 0.099, 0.925, 0.761, 0.343, respectively); suggesting that the treatment regimens of the observation group and the conventional control group were clinically effective, and that the two regimens were comparable in terms of efficacy. The peripheral blood eosinophil counts of the observation group and the conventional control group decreased significantly from the baseline status at 4-6 months, 1 year and 2 years of treatment (t-values of the conventional group were 3.453, 5.469, 6.273, P-values <0.05, and the t-values of the observation group were 2.900, 4.575, 5.988, P-values <0.05, respectively). 4-6 months, 1 year and 2 years compared with the baseline status tIgE showed a trend of increasing and then decreasing (t-value in the conventional group was -5.328, -4.254, -0.690, P-value was 0.000, 0.000, 0.492, respectively, and t-value in the observation group was -6.087, -5.087, -0.324, P-value was 0.000, 0.000, 0.745, respectively). However, the results of intergroup comparisons showed no statistically significant differences in serological indices and efficacy between the two groups in terms of peripheral blood eosinophil counts at baseline status, 4-6 months, 1 year and 2 years (t-values of 0.723, 1.553, 0.766, and 0.234, respectively; P-values of 0.471, 0.122, 0.445, and 0.815, respectively), tIgE (t-values of 0.170, -0.166, -0.449, 0.839, P-values 0.865, 0.868, 0.654, 0.403, respectively), tIgG4 (t-values 1.507, 1.467, -0.337, 0.804, P-values 0.134, 0.145, 0.737, 0.422, respectively). Conclusion: Both immunotherapy regimens for airway allergic diseases with double mite allergen subcutaneous immunotherapy have significant clinical efficacy, low incidence of adverse reactions, and the observation group has better patient compliance than the control group.

To evaluate the modification of allergic dermatitis on the association between PM exposure and allergic rhinitis in preschool children. This cross-sectional study was based on a questionnaire conducted between June 2019 and June 2020 to caregivers of children aged 3 to 6 years in the kindergartens of 7 Chinese cities to collect information on allergic rhinitis and allergic dermatitis. A mature machine learning-based space-time extremely randomized trees model was applied to estimate early-life, prenatal, and first-year exposure of PM1, PM2.5 and PM10 at 1 km×1 km resolution. A combination of multilevel logistic regression and restricted cubic spline functions was used to quantitatively assess whether allergic dermatitis modifies the associations between size-specific PM exposure and the risk of childhood allergic rhinitis. The results showed that out of 28 408 children, 14 803 (52.1%) were boys and 13 605 (47.9%) were girls; the age of children ranged from 3.1 to 6.8 years, with a mean age of (4.9±0.9) years, of which 3 586 (12.6%) were diagnosed with allergic rhinitis. Among all children, 17 832 (62.8%) were breastfed for more than 6 months and 769 (2.7%) had parental history of atopy. A total of 21 548 children (75.9%) had a mother with an educational level of university or above and 7 338 (29.6%) had passive household cigarette smoke exposure. The adjusted ORs for childhood allergic rhinitis among the children with allergic dermatitis as per interquartile range (IQR) increase in early-life PM1(9.8 µg/m3), PM2.5 (14.9 µg/m3) and PM10 (37.7 µg/m3) were significantly higher than the corresponding ORs among the children without allergic dermatitis [OR: 1.45, 95%CI (1.26, 1.66) vs. 1.33, 95%CI (1.20, 1.47), for PM1; OR: 1.38, 95%CI (1.23, 1.56) vs. 1.32, 95%CI (1.21, 1.45), for PM2.5; OR: 1.56, 95%CI (1.31, 1.86) vs. 1.46, 95%CI (1.28, 1.67), for PM10]. The interactions between allergic dermatitis and size-specific PM exposure on childhood allergic rhinitis were statistically significant (Z value=19.4, all P for interaction<0.001). The similar patterns were observed for both prenatal and first-year size-specific PM exposure and the results of the dose-response relationship were consistent with those of the logistic regression. In conclusion, allergic dermatitis, as an important part of the allergic disease progression, may modify the association between ambient PM exposure and the risk of childhood allergic rhinitis. Children with allergic dermatitis should pay more attention to minimize outdoor air pollutants exposure to prevent the further progression of allergic diseases.

This study was to investigate the relationship between spring pollen distribution concentration, species and the detection results of air-borne pollen allergens in Taiyuan City, Shanxi Province during March to May 2022 and March to May 2023.A retrospective study was conducted in the Otorhinolaryngology Head and Neck Surgery Clinic of the First Hospital of Shanxi Medical University.Pollen particles will be monitored by gravity sedimentation method on the roof of the outpatient department of the First Hospital of Shanxi Medical University in downtown Taiyuan from March to May 2022-2023, and pollen species and quantity will be observed and recorded under an optical microscope.The air-borne pollen allergen detection results of all allergic rhinitis patients in the otolaryngology Head and Neck surgery Department of the First Hospital of Shanxi Medical University were extracted from the relevant outpatient system. SPSS software and Pearson correlation analysis were used to compare the correlation between the allergens and the dominant air-borne pollen monitoring results. Results are as follows: (1)A total of 18 species of spring pollen in Taiyuan City were monitored in 2022-2023, with 101 177.5 grains, and the dominant airborne pollen was poplar (16.69%) and pine (29.06%) pollen. The pollen of poplar (11.96%), elm (7.89%) and cypress (8.68%) were dominant in early spring; Pine (25.16%) pollen predominated in late spring. The two peaks of pollen dispersal in Taiyuan were in late March (15 479 grains) and early and mid May (15 094/15 343 grains).(2) The positive rates of allergens in serum specific IgE detection were: wormwood (46%, 248/541 cases), tree combination (26%, 143/541 cases), ragweed (19%, 101/541 cases), humulus scandens (9%, 49/541 cases).(3)There was a linear positive correlation between the positive rate of air-borne pollen allergens in allergic rhinitis patients in the Department of Otolaryngology Head and Neck Surgery in the First Hospital of Shanxi Medical University and the dominant air-borne pollen concentration in the same period (P<0.05, r=0.999). In conclusion, two spring pollen dispersal peaks were formed in late March and early to mid May in Taiyuan City, and the dominant air-borne pollens were poplar and pine pollens. The positive rate of air borne pollen allergen sIgE showed that wormwood allergy was the highest.There was a positive correlation between the concentration of air-borne pollen and the positive rate of air-borne pollen allergens in patients with allergic rhinitis in the Department of otorhinolaryngology and head and neck surgery in Taiyuan in 2022 and 2023.The monitoring of pollen distribution in spring can provide an important scientific basis for clinical workers to formulate prevention and treatment plans for patients with allergic rhinitis in the season, and provide data reference for the epidemiological investigation of allergic diseases in Taiyuan in the future.

Aim: To evaluate the criteria used by allergists in selecting an immunotherapy extract (allergen immunotherapy [AIT]-extract) in rhinitis patients with polysensitization. Methods: First, a cross-sectional study was carried out by evaluating different factors that influence the medical choice of AIT-extract. Second, a literature review was performed by evaluating the diagnostic performance of atopy tests. Results: A total of 419 patients were included (84 children, 149 adolescents and 186 adults). Anamnesis, atopy tests and exposure to pets were the main factors for choosing the AIT extract. The sensitivity and specificity of atopy tests were high for Dermatophagoides spp., (>80%), moderate for pets (60%) and indeterminate for Blomia tropicalis. Conclusion: NCTs could be necessary for AIT-extract selection in polysensitized allergic rhinitis patients.


Allergen immunotherapy is an effective treatment for patients with allergic rhinitis. Atopy tests are used to identify possible substances in the environment that cause symptoms. A patient may sometimes have multiple substances which could be causing their allergic reactions, which makes it difficult to choose the appropriate immunotherapy for the patient. In this study, we identified some factors that might help to guide the criteria used by allergists when selecting the extract for immunotherapy.

BACKGROUND: A chronic condition that significantly reduces a child's quality of life is allergic rhinitis (AR). The environment and allergens that the body is regularly exposed to can cause inflammatory and immunological reactions, which can change the expression of certain genes Epigenetic changes are closely linked to the onset and severity of allergy disorders according to mounting amounts of data. Noncoding RNAs (ncRNAs) are a group of RNA molecules that cannot be converted into polypeptides. The three main categories of ncRNAs include microRNAs (miRNAs), long noncoding RNAs (lncRNAs), and circular RNAs (circRNAs). NcRNAs play a crucial role in controlling gene expression and contribute to the development of numerous human diseases. METHODS: Articles are selected based on Pubmed's literature review and the author's personal knowledge. The largest and highest quality studies were included. The search selection is not standardized. RESULTS: Recent findings indicate that various categories of ncRNAs play distinct yet interconnected roles and actively contribute to intricate gene regulatory networks. CONCLUSION: This article demonstrates the significance and progress of ncRNAs in children's AR. The database covers three key areas: miRNAs, lncRNAs, and circRNAs. Additionally, potential avenues for future research to facilitate the practical application of ncRNAs as therapeutic targets and biomarkers will be explore.

INTRODUCTION: Global warming appears to initiate and aggravate allergic respiratory conditions via interaction with numerous environmental factors. Temperature, commonly identified as a factor in climate change, is important in this process. Allergic rhinitis, a common respiratory allergy, is on the rise and affects approximately 500 million individuals worldwide. The increasing ambient temperature requires evaluation regarding its influence on allergic rhinitis, taking into account regional climate zones. METHODS: A detailed search of PubMed, EMBASE, Scopus, Web of Science, MEDLINE, and CINAHL Plus databases, was conducted, encompassing observational studies published from 1991 to 2023. Original studies examining the relationship between increasing temperature and allergic rhinitis were assessed for eligibility followed by a risk of bias assessment. Random effects meta-analysis was utilized to measure the association between a 1 °C increase in temperature and allergic rhinitis-related outcomes. RESULTS: 20 studies were included in the qualitative synthesis, with nine of them subsequently selected for the quantitative synthesis. 20 included studies were rated as Level 4 evidence according to the Oxford Centre for Evidence-Based Medicine, and the majority of these reported good-quality evidence based on the Newcastle-Ottawa Quality Rating Scale. Using the Risk of Bias In Non-Randomized Studies of Exposure tool, the majority of studies exhibit a high risk of bias. Every 1 °C increase in temperature significantly raised the risk of allergic rhinitis-related outcomes by 29 % (RR = 1.26, 95 % CI: 1.11 to 1.50). Conversely, every 1 °C rise in temperature showed no significant increase in the odds of allergic rhinitis-related outcomes by 7 % (OR = 1.07, 95 % CI: 0.95 to 1.21). Subsequent subgroup analysis identified climate zone as an influential factor influencing this association. CONCLUSION: It is inconclusive to definitively suggest a harmful effect of increasing temperature exposure on allergic rhinitis, due overall very low certainty of evidence. Further original research with better methodological quality is required.
